intestine
/ɪnˈtɛstaɪn//ɪnˈtɛstɪn/
noun
- 1
(often pluralized) The alimentary canal of an animal through which food passes after having passed all stomachs.
- 2
One of certain subdivisions of this part of the alimentary canal, such as the small or large intestine in human beings.
adjective
- 1
Domestic; taking place within a given country or region.
- 2
Internal.
- 3
Depending upon the internal constitution of a body or entity; subjective.
- 4
Shut up; enclosed.
